A phrase is a group of words commonly used together (e.g., once upon a time).
phrase
a. big things
Tú y yo somos muy distintas. A ti suele impresionarte lo grande, mientras que a mí me atraen los pequeños detalles.You and I are very different. You tend to be in awe of big things, whereas I feel drawn to the small details.
b. big
Lo grande siempre es mejor. - A veces lo óptimo es lo pequeño.Big is always better. - Sometimes small things are best.
a. really big
¡Lo grande que es esta ciudad, Virgen santa!Holy cow, this city is really big!
b. how big
No era verdaderamente consciente de lo grande que es este país.I wasn't truly aware of how big this country is.
c. how large
No te imaginas lo grande que es la tienda.You can't imagine how large the store is.
a. really tall
¡Lo grande que está la pequeña Belén!Little Belen is really tall!
b. how tall
¿Viste lo grande que está mi niño?Did you see how tall my kid is?
